Ingredients
Scale
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
- 3 tablespoons butter, divided
- 1 ½ pounds chicken breasts, diced
- 3 tablespoons honey
- 2 tablespoons apple cider vinegar
- 3 garlic cloves, minced
- Salt and pepper to taste
- Fresh parsley for garnish
Instructions
- Preheat a large skillet over medium-high heat. Add olive oil and 1 tablespoon of butter.
- Add diced chicken to the skillet and cook for about 6-8 minutes until browned.
- In a separate bowl, mix honey, apple cider vinegar, minced garlic, salt, and pepper.
- Pour the sauce over the cooked chicken along with the remaining butter. Cook for an additional 3-4 minutes until bubbly.
- Serve hot over rice or with your favorite sides.
- Prep Time: 10 minutes
- Cook Time: 10 minutes
